[0001] This utility model relates to the field of plate and frame filter press technology, and in particular to a safety protection device for preventing hand pinching in plate and frame filter presses. Background Technology

[0002] The filter press currently used in the wet acetylene process is a plate and frame filter press. The filtered filter cake has high viscosity and strong adhesion, so it needs to be cleaned manually. During the cleaning process, the pull rope needs to be pulled to stop the plate puller before cleaning. In actual use, due to the high failure rate of the pull rope switch and the frequent pulling of the rope, personnel often clean the filter cake while the plate puller is still running, which can easily cause arm injuries.

[0003] When a plate and frame filter press is in use, the mechanical action of the filter plates closing and assembling poses significant operational safety hazards. Traditional safety protection devices for filter presses mostly use mechanical limit switches or infrared beam sensors. However, these technologies have inherent defects. Mechanical switches are prone to failure due to long-term mechanical wear and have a delayed response. Although infrared sensors can achieve non-contact detection, in humid and dusty conditions, tiny particles in the air, such as dust and water mist, will strongly scatter and absorb the infrared beam, leading to signal attenuation or false triggering. Especially during the dynamic process of the filter plates closing, a sudden increase in dust concentration can directly cause the detection system to misjudge, resulting in unplanned equipment shutdown or failure of safety interlocks. Such problems are particularly prominent in typical application scenarios such as mine tailings treatment and chemical sludge dewatering. Due to the high moisture content of the materials and the open working environment, the interference of mixed suspended particles of dust and water mist on the beam transmission channel increases exponentially, leading to an increased false alarm rate of traditional photoelectric detection systems and severely restricting the continuous operation capability of the equipment.

[0007] Preferably, when the plate and frame filter press is in use, symmetrically arranged laser emitters and receivers at the top of the mounting columns on both the left and right ends of the filter press body constitute the core detection system. The laser emitters continuously emit directional beams. After the beams pass through the working area of ​​the filter press, they are precisely captured by the symmetrically positioned laser receivers, forming an invisible laser beam barrier. This barrier acts like a virtual barrier, monitoring the integrity of the beam path in real time. When an operator's limb or a foreign object enters the working area of ​​the filter press, it will inevitably block the laser beam. Once the laser receiver detects light intensity attenuation or light path interruption, it immediately sends a trigger signal to the control system. The control system immediately cuts off the power supply to the filter press, forcibly stopping the filter plate closing action, thus eliminating the risk of pinching hands at the source. At the same time, the high-pressure air pump is started to draw in ambient air and pressurize and deliver it. When the high-pressure gas is delivered to the high-pressure nozzle through the high-pressure air pipe, it will encounter a specially designed guide structure and be fixed in place. The guide tube in front of the nozzle is equipped with spiral blades. When the high-pressure airflow passes through the spiral blades, it is forced to rotate. After leaving the guide tube, this rotating airflow is further transformed into a vortex airflow extending along the beam axis by the guiding effect of the front frustum guide tube. This spiral air curtain can not only effectively remove dust, water mist and other floating objects on the beam path and maintain the cleanliness of the laser transmission channel, but also reduce the scattering interference of small particles on the beam through airflow disturbance, thereby significantly improving the anti-interference capability of the laser detection system. [0030] When the laser emitter 3 or receiver needs to be repaired, the operator only needs to pull the locking rod 20 upward to overcome the elastic force of the locking spring 23, so that the lower end of the locking rod 20 disengages from the locking hole 21 of the storage box 13. At this time, the storage box 13 is unlocked. By pulling it outward with the handle 14, the storage box 13 can be smoothly slid out along the guide groove 16. The cooperation between the guide block 18 and the guide rod 17 ensures the straightness of the pulling process. After the storage box 13 is completely pulled out, the internal components can be maintained or replaced. After completion, it can be automatically reset by pushing it in the opposite direction. The locking mechanism is re-locked under the action of the spring.
